Oatmeal Raisin Cookies
Print Recipe
Pin Recipe
Course
Dessert
Ingredients
1
cup
unsalted butter (2 sticks)
at room temperature
1
cup
brown sugar
lightly packed
1
cup
sugar
2
extra-large eggs
at room temperature
2
tsp
vanilla extract
1 1/2
cups
of flour
1
tsp
baking powder
1
tsp
ground cinnamon
1
tsp
salt
3
cups
old-fashioned oatmeal
2
cups
raisins
Instructions
In a large bowl, beat butter and sugars until light and fluffy.
Beat in eggs one at a time, followed by the vanilla.
In a separate bowl, sift together flour, baking powder, cinnamon and salt.
Slowly add in dry ingredients to the butter mixture.
Add in the oats and raisins and mix until just combined.
Drop tablespoon sized mounds onto parchment paper lined cookie sheets and bake at 350 for 12-15 minutes or until lightly golden.
Let cool on a baking rack. Enjoy.
Notes
*Ina also used 1 1/2 cups of coarsely chopped toasted pecans, but I didn't have any on hand.
